Surface Agitation Without Capture — The Most Common Shortcut in Fort Hall, ID

The most common shortcut is agitating contamination in the ducts without capturing it in Fort Hall. A technician who runs a brush through a duct run without connected negative pressure dislodges the contamination from the duct walls and releases it into the airstream in Fort Hall, ID. That contamination then settles throughout the home or is redistributed by the HVAC in Fort Hall. The ducts look cleaner at the point of agitation. The home's air quality is temporarily worse because the contamination has been redistributed in Fort Hall, ID. Correct cleaning requires negative pressure established before any agitation begins so that every particle dislodged is captured rather than released in Fort Hall.

Portable Vacuums vs Truck-Mounted Equipment in Fort Hall, ID

A portable vacuum unit connected to a residential duct system creates approximately 150 to 200 CFM of suction at the connection point in Fort Hall. The suction drops significantly as distance from the connection point increases, meaning duct runs more than a short distance from the vacuum receive little to no effective suction in Fort Hall, ID. A truck-mounted vacuum unit creates 3,000 to 5,000 CFM or more of sustained suction capacity in Fort Hall. This capacity maintains meaningful negative pressure throughout the complete duct system, capturing dislodged contamination from every duct run regardless of distance from the connection point in Fort Hall, ID. There is no portable unit that replicates this capacity in Fort Hall.

NADCA is the National Air Duct Cleaners Association, the professional organization that sets standards for correct air duct cleaning in Fort Hall. NADCA certification requires demonstrated knowledge of duct system construction, contamination types, source removal methods, and equipment requirements in Fort Hall, ID. A certified technician is trained to perform a cleaning that meets the standard in Fort Hall.
Negative pressure is the sustained suction throughout the duct system that captures contamination dislodged during cleaning before it can re-enter the living space in Fort Hall. Without negative pressure established before agitation begins, the cleaning process dislodges contamination from the duct walls and releases it into the airstream where it redistributes throughout the home in Fort Hall, ID. Negative pressure is what makes the difference between removing contamination and redistributing it in Fort Hall.
